Media Coordinator: Job Description 

Media Coordinators act as communication professionals for companies and clients. The Media Coordinator uses multimedia mediums to promote a company or a client’s products and services. It includes print, broadcast, and online mediums. They evaluate companies’ needs and purchase print space, broadcasting time, and internet or social media exposure. 

The media Coordinator performs research and analyzes statistics & data to formulate effective and Cost-efficient advertising and marketing campaigns. They keep a keen eye on the latest market trend, and customers need to prepare media campaigns as per their understanding.

 The Media Coordinator acts as a team player and continuously works with the marketing team. It helps to understand the audience, determine objectives and formulate the correct strategy as per the client’s needs. To Excel in this position, the Media Coordinator needs to reflect the excellent organization, communication, and multitasking skills to deliver profit-worthy results.

Duties and Responsibilities of Media Coordinator

Companies appoint Media Coordinators to plan advertising and marketing campaigns for the promotion of products and services. They identify and use print, broadcast, and digital mediums that fit with the client’s needs. 

Mainly, their duties include meeting with clients to formulate media plans and discuss budget, choosing the Media that go with clients’ products or services, arranging for purchasing advertising time & space, and ensuring that the advertisement placement goes accurately. 

Media Coordinator duties get divided between numerous media individuals. It includes: 

Media Supervisor, Director, and Planner 

  • They have to formulate and execute different media strategies that match the client’s needs. 
  • They need to train and supervise the working of media buyers 
  • They keep a keen eye on the proper usage of the available budget and ensure that all the invoices get paid on time 
  • Sometimes, they purchase advertising space for products and services 

Media Buyers 

  • Assigned to negotiate advertising price for getting ad space in print, broadcast, and digital medium 
  • They ensure that advertising cost remains under client’s budget 
  • They need to determine the best available print and broadcast mediums as per the broadcast rating and periodical circulation 
  • They need to monitor and secure that vendors follow the terms of their agreement  

Executive Director of Media 

  • Assigned to create and maintain professional relationships with companies or clients and different media agencies
  • They need to monitor media strategies for the client 
  • They oversee the working of media coordination staff members 
  • Sometimes, they have to identify and develop new business opportunities and formulate strategies to maximize profits 

Digital Media Coordinators 

  • Unlike social media coordinators and community managers, their work goes beyond product and services promotion on social media platforms. 
  • They formulate and implement different online advertising strategies 
  • They identify search engine advertising strategies that help to develop and improve the search performance of clients or the company’s website 
  • It may include purchasing online advertising space for the promotion of clients products or services in online mediums

What is the Salary of a Media Coordinator? 

As per ziprecruiters.com salary postings, a Media Coordinator gets an average salary of $40,506 per year in the United States. Most of the Media Coordinators’ average salary lies between $34,500 per year to $45,500 per year.

Media Coordinators salary keeps on varying depending on numerous factors. It includes locations, experience, education, skills, and organization. For example, the newbies with less experience can earn around $23,000 per year, while the top earners with years of experience get an annual average salary of $56,000 per year. 

To advance in your career, you can look for locations that offer a higher salary for a Media Coordinator. Also, ensure the region you choose has a low cost of living to get maximum profit. Here is the list of top-earning cities in the United States:

Top 10 Salary Paying Cities for Media Coordinator 

Cities Average Annual Salary Wages per Hour 
San Jose, California $50,031$24.05
Oakland, California $49,454$23.78
Tanaina, Alaska $49,230$23.67
Wasilla, Alaska $49,230$23.67
Hayward, California $48,419$23.28
Seattle, Washington $48,092$23.12
Concord, California $47,972$23.06
Sunnyvale, California $47,698$22.93
Santa Cruz, California $47,146$22.67
Seaside, California $46,522$22.37

How much Salary Media Coordinator get in different Industries? 

Apart from location, Industry acts as a crucial factor to determine media coordinators’ salaries. As per zippia.com, the media coordinator gets a higher salary in the technology industry whereas hospitality pays the lowest salary. 

Here is the list of average salaries of Media Coordinators in different industries

Industry Average Annual Media Coordinator Salary 
Technology$46,545
Professional$43,043
Finance$42,036
Media$42,007
Education$41,280
Health Care$41,074
Retail$40,402
Hospitality$37,460

Media Coordinators Salary as per Education Level 

Education is another crucial factor for determining a media coordinator’s salary. Although you can enter this field with only a High School Degree or GED, you need to acquire further education to get better earnings. 

Here is a list is Media Coordinators Salary with Educational levels as per Zippia.com 

Educational LevelAnnual Average Salary 
Bachelor’s  Degree$41,959
Master’s Degree$47,024
Doctorate Degree$47,017

How to become Media Coordinator?

Media Coordinators need to perform numerous tasks and identify the best media platforms for advertising or marketing. If you are interested in the position of media coordinator, you can follow the following steps: 

Step 1: Acquire a Degree 

If you want to become a media coordinator, you can begin your career in this field by acquiring the correct degree. You can get a bachelor’s degree in marketing, communication, media, advertising, and other related subjects. 

Although most employers look for individuals with bachelor’s and even master’s degrees, you can start your career as a Media Coordinator with a High School Diploma or GED. 

Step 2: Gain Experience 

Most organizations hire media coordinators with at least two to three of experience in the relevant position. You can start by joining media or communication clubs in college. It will help to gain experience with handling content, advertising, and marketing for online, broadcasting, and print medium. 

Try to attend guest lectures and seminars organized for media students and ask professionals about advertising and marketing queries. It will help you get clarity about this career. 

Other than that, you can get an internship during or after obtaining a degree. Search for internships that offer a better understanding of content creation, editing, advertising, and communication.

Step 3: Make Connections and Advance in Your Career 

Connections play a vital role in getting into the position of media coordinator. You can start by attending job fairs and lectures organized by institutions. Try to interact with professionals, ask about their company’s current job openings, take their information (like contact number & email ID), and give your resumes or CV to them. 

You can join counseling sessions organized by career advisors. They will guide you about your job as media Coordinator and tell you how numerous departments function. 

Apart from that, you can advance in your career by participating in the company’s informational interviews. It will help you to meet with business professionals and ask questions about the media coordinator’s profession. Also, you can interact and form connections with valuable people. 

Step 4: Sharpen Your Skills 

Apart from education, you need to possess and sharpen some necessary skills to strengthen your position as a Media Coordinator. Some of the essential skills include:-

Technical Skills 

Media Coordinators need to be familiar with the latest software and technology. It includes the use of software like Search Engine Optimization, Web Metrics, Google Analytics, etc. It will help to create effective content to raise maximum profit. 

Communication Skills 

As a Media Coordinator, you need to communicate with clients, team members as well as the audience. Verbal communication helps to answer queries, interact with clients, and communicate effectively with different media houses. 

Written Communication Skills help to write catchy and precise content to grab the audience. Also, it allows generating buyers for products or services. 

Writing Skills 

Content is a vital part of advertising and marketing. Advertisers use a few catchy lines to create an impact on the audience. Media Coordinators need to possess excellent writing skills to write and edit content for advertisement on numerous mediums. 

Interpersonal Skills 

The Media Coordinator can’t perform all the work solely. They need to lead their staff members, interact with different departments before formulating creative content. Processing interpersonal skills help to form good relationships with team members, media agencies, and various media departments. 

Content Marketing Skills 

The Media Coordinator needs to perform various roles. It includes content creator, editor, writer, data analyst, combination & marketing expert. Possessing marketing skills helps to choose the best platform for a client’s product or service promotion. You can sharpen this skill by learning SEO or other marketing tools. It will help to choose cost-effective content like blog, website, advertisement, or social media posts. 

Analytical Skills 

Analytics play a pivotal role in advertising and marketing. It will help to determine the latest trends, previous mistakes and increase sales. The Media Coordinate needs to possess and sharpen analytical skills by learning the latest analytical tools. You can understand data analysis tools to determine the cost, perform research and generate profitable solutions. 

Problem-Solving Skills

The media Coordinator needs to take responsibility if any issues occur. It includes recognizing problems in advertising and content. After identifying issues, they need to come up with constructive and appropriate solutions. 

Step 5: Apply for Media Coordinator Job 

Once you acquire the necessary education, understanding, and experience, you can start applying for the Media Coordinators job. Look at the latest job openings at Job Portals and the company’s website. 

Whenever you apply for the Media Coordinator Job, make sure to send an updated CV and resume. It should reflect recruiters why you qualify for this position. Also, attach work samples to show what kind of posts and content you can create.
